A dark, sad story
Testament of Youth is one of those films that isn’t terrible, but it’s brilliant either. It’s just a good solid film. It has a great cast, especially Alicia Vikander, all of whom put on very good performances. It’s very strange to see Kit Harington in something other than Game of Thrones, and it takes a while to get used to this but he does very well. The script is good and the story itself is pretty sad and harrowing. Kind of what you’d expect with a romantic film based around the First World War, but it was still quite saddening and painful to watch. An all round good and intriguing film to watch.

The Clone Wars Edition of Risk is one of my favorite board games. It's the Republic vs the Separatists, and it's such a fun variation. Of course, it does only end one way, but it's still fun. I'm sad they don't produce it anymore, because copies of the game are now $60+.
